随着科技的迅速发展,加密货币作为一种革命性的资产类别,正引起全球各界越来越多的关注。比特币的初始推出标...
在数字经济日益发展的今天,加密货币作为一种创新的金融工具,已经获得了越来越多人的关注。许多人都对如何创作自己的加密货币充满好奇,不仅是因为它们的投资潜力,还有其背后的科技魅力。本文将为你提供一个全面的指南,帮助你了解如何创作加密货币的整个过程,同时解答与之相关的多个问题。
加密货币是一种利用密码学技术来确保交易安全、控制新单位生成和验证资产转移的数字货币。简单来说,加密货币使得数字交易既安全又透明。自比特币于2009年问世以来,各种类型的加密货币如雨后春笋般涌现,其中包括以太坊、莱特币等。对于创作加密货币,我们需要先了解以下几个基本概念。
1. **区块链**:区块链是加密货币的基础技术,是一种分布式的数据库,可以确保数据的透明和安全。
2. **代币与币种**:代币是基于现有区块链平台(如以太坊)创建的,而币种则通常具有自己独立的区块链(如比特币)。
3. **智能合约**:它是一种自动执行合约条款的程序,通常在以太坊网络上运行,能够帮助开发者创建复杂的应用程序。
接下来,我们进入创建加密货币的具体步骤。整个过程可以分为几个主要阶段:
在开始创作之前,首先要明确你想创建的是“币”还是“代币”。币种如比特币,有自己的区块链,而代币则是依托其他区块链平台(如以太坊)创建的。如果预算有限,可以选择创建代币。
创建新加密货币时,需要设计货币模型,包括发行额度、流通机制、奖励机制等。你需要考虑以下几个重要
- **总量**:你的加密货币计划发行多少个单位?是固定发行,还是采用通胀模型?
- **分配**:如何分配这些货币?是给开发团队、早期投资者,还是社区?
- **激励机制**:如何激励用户持有和使用你的加密货币?这直接关系到它的市场接受度。
对于大多数希望创建代币的开发者来说,使用像以太坊这样的现成区块链平台是最方便的选择。以太坊的智能合约功能使得代币创建变得相对简单。其他选择还有币安智能链、波场等。
在选择好区块链平台后,就需要编写智能合约来实现你的币的功能。这包括定义代币的名称、符号、发行数量等。你可以使用Solidity等编程语言进行开发。如果你不自己编程,可以考虑雇佣开发者。
在开发完成后,需要在区块链上部署智能合约,并进行测试,确保系统的安全性和功能正常。部署过程中也可以选择进行代码审计,以避免潜在的漏洞和安全问题。
一旦代币开发完成并经过测试,就可以考虑向加密货币交易所提交申请。与此同时,进行有效的市场营销,推广你的加密货币,吸引投资者和用户。
开发加密货币并不一定需要精通计算机科学,但有一定的基础是非常有帮助的。以下是你可能需要了解的一些技术要求:
1. **编程语言**:常见的开发语言包括Solidity(用于以太坊),JavaScript(用于Web应用)等。虽然有些相关的功能可以利用现成的工具进行创建,但掌握基础的编程语言可以帮助你更灵活地应对问题。
2. **区块链知识**:了解区块链的基本原理及其区块结构、共识机制等,对于开发者来说极为重要。
3. **智能合约**:掌握智能合约的概念和如何编写智能合约,将直接影响你代币的功能和安全性。
4. **安全性考虑**:安全问题绝对是重中之重,掌握基本的网络安全知识、数据加密和权限管理等都是必须的。
正确掌握这些技能将大大提高你开发加密货币的成功率。
在创作加密货币的过程中,需要考虑多方面的费用,具体包括:
1. **开发成本**:如果自己不能编程,你可能需要雇佣开发者来协助。开发团队的费用因地区、项目复杂度而异,一般可以在几千到几万美元不等。
2. **智能合约审计费用**:为了确保安全,通常需要专业的第三方进行智能合约审计,审计费用一般在几百到几千美元之间。
3. **交易所上架费用**:许多交易所要求支付一定的费用才能将代币上架,该费用可能从几千到几万美元不等,具体取决于交易所的知名度和条件。
4. **市场推广费用**:最初推广代币通常需要一定的预算,包括社交媒体广告、社区活动、项目网站等。
5. **维护成本**:发布后,还需定期维护、更新和支持用户,所以也要考虑这部分的持续支出。
是的,可以在不同的区块链上创造加密货币。常见的区块链包括以太坊、币安智能链、波场等。每种区块链都有其社区、特点和生态系统。
1. **以太坊**:它是最流行的智能合约平台,支持ERC-20协议,非常适合开发以太坊代币。开发者社区强大,资源丰富。
2. **币安智能链**:作为一个与以太坊兼容的区块链,币安智能链以其较低的交易费用和较快的交易确认速度吸引了一大批开发者。
3. **波场**:波场同样支持智能合约,且其交易费用相对较低,对于一些小型项目非常友好。
每种区块链选择都有其优缺点,开发者需要根据项目的需求、目标用户、生态系统等进行综合考虑。
加密货币的法律合规性通常是开发者中最容易忽视的部分,但它对项目的成功至关重要。建议采取以下步骤:
1. **法律咨询**:创建前最好咨询专业的法律顾问,确保项目符合所在国家/地区的法律法规。加密法律规则各国差异很大。
2. **了解监管要求**:不同国家对加密货币的规定不同,像中国严格禁止ICO和加密交易,而一些国家则采取积极的监管政策。
3. **白皮书的合规性**:发布项目时,准备一份合规的白皮书,避免误导投资者,尽量透明地说明项目的目标、预算、团队背景等。
4. **遵循KYC/AML规定**:在引入投资时,一些国家可能要求对投资者进行KYC(知道你的客户)和AML(反洗钱)审查。
5. **持牌要求**:某些地区对加密货币交易平台提供服务设有持牌要求,确保你的项目在法律框架内运行。
提升加密货币的知名度和接受度,涉及多个方面的努力:
1. **社区建设**:建立一个活跃的社区是项目成功的关键。利用社交网络、论坛、Telegram、Discord等平台,与潜在用户建立联系并进行互动。
2. **合理的营销策略**:通过内容营销、社交媒体广告、博客和公关活动提高项目的曝光率。可以考虑和加密货币领域的网红、博主进行合作。
3. **建立合作伙伴关系**:与其他区块链项目、公司或机构建立合作关系,可以共同进行推广,扩大项目影响力。
4. **参加行业活动**:参加区块链及加密货币相关活动、会议、展会,能有效地让更多人了解你的项目,并吸引投资者关注。
5. **持续更新和反馈**:保持良好的互动,定期发布进展更新,并对社区反馈给予重视,展现出项目的透明性和专业性。
以上就是关于如何创作加密货币的全面指南。在这个复杂而充满挑战的领域,知识、技能和合规性是成功的关键。希望本文能为你提供有价值的参考,助你在加密世界中迅速启航。